Title :
Tracking filters for translational and rotational motion components of high resolution radar targets

Abstract :
This work deals with the development of new processing techniques to estimate both translational and rotational motion components of vehicles from high resolution radar images. The different techniques proposed in this work make different use of prior knowledge in terms of target RCS database and of the possible presence of accurate GPS measurements. The effectiveness of the proposed techniques are demonstrated by application to an emulated trajectory based on MSTAR images.
